Overview
The CWS-255: Citrix DaaS Deployment and Administration course equips IT professionals with the skills to design, deploy, and manage Citrix DaaS environments. Participants will learn to migrate from on-premises Citrix Virtual Apps and Desktops to Citrix DaaS, configure Citrix Cloud Connectors, manage resource locations, and deliver secure apps and desktops via Citrix Cloud.
Objectives
By the end of this course, leaner will be able to:
- Understand the differences between Citrix Virtual Apps and Desktops 2402 LTSR on-premises and Citrix DaaS.
- Install, configure, and manage Citrix Cloud Connectors.
- Create and provision Citrix DaaS workloads.
- Deliver and secure app and desktop resources for end users.
- Migrate from on-premises Citrix Virtual Apps and Desktops to Citrix DaaS.
- Manage, monitor, and optimize Citrix DaaS deployments.
Prerequisites
- Strong foundational knowledge of Windows Server and Windows Desktop operating systems.
- Familiarity with Active Directory, policies, profiles, networking, and hypervisors.
- Prior attendance in CVAD-201 is recommended.
